sqlite 查看数据库版本号 (查询语句 + 操作方法) 2024 最全攻略!

码农 by:码农 分类:数据库 时间:2025/02/25 阅读:5 评论:0
在 SQLite 数据库中,查看数据库版本号是一项基本操作。通过特定的查询语句和操作方法,我们可以轻松获取到数据库的版本信息。这对于数据库管理和维护非常重要。接下来,我们将详细介绍如何在 SQLite 中查看数据库版本号。


一、查询语句介绍

在 SQLite 中,我们可以使用 PRAGMA 语句来获取数据库的版本号。PRAGMA 是 SQLite 中的一个特殊语句,用于执行数据库级别的操作。以下是获取数据库版本号的查询语句:

PRAGMA user_version;

这个查询语句将返回当前数据库的版本号。如果数据库没有设置版本号,它将返回 0。


二、操作方法

要在 SQLite 中执行上述查询语句并查看数据库版本号,你可以使用以下步骤:

步骤 1:打开 SQLite 数据库。你可以使用 SQLite 命令行工具或在编程语言中使用 SQLite 数据库连接库来打开数据库。

步骤 2:在打开的数据库连接中,执行上述查询语句。你可以使用 SQL 命令或编程语言中的数据库操作函数来执行查询。

步骤 3:获取查询结果。查询结果将包含数据库的版本号。你可以将结果打印出来或在程序中进行进一步处理。


三、示例代码

以下是一个使用 Python 语言连接 SQLite 数据库并查看版本号的示例代码:

import sqlite3

def get_sqlite_version(): try: conn = sqlite3.connect('your_database.db') cursor = conn.cursor() cursor.execute("PRAGMA user_version;") version = cursor.fetchone()[0] print("Database version:", version) cursor.close() conn.close() except sqlite3.Error as e: print("Error accessing database:", e)

在上述代码中,我们定义了一个名为 get_sqlite_version 的函数,该函数用于连接到指定的 SQLite 数据库,并执行查询语句获取版本号。它将打印出数据库的版本号。

你需要将 'your_database.db' 替换为你实际使用的数据库文件名。

通过以上步骤,你可以在 SQLite 中轻松查看数据库的版本号。这对于了解数据库的特性和进行兼容性测试非常有帮助。

在 SQLite 中查看数据库版本号可以通过 PRAGMA user_version 语句来实现。通过执行该语句并获取结果,我们可以获取到数据库的版本信息。在实际应用中,了解数据库的版本号可以帮助我们进行数据库管理和维护,以及确保应用程序与数据库的兼容性。

以下是提炼的问题: 1. 如何在 SQLite 中使用 PRAGMA 语句获取数据库版本号? 2. 连接 SQLite 数据库并查看版本号的步骤有哪些? 3. 有哪些编程语言可以用于连接 SQLite 数据库并查看版本号? 4. 获取到的 SQLite 数据库版本号有什么作用?
非特殊说明,本文版权归原作者所有,转载请注明出处

本文地址:https://chinaasp.com/20250211695.html


TOP